Safety

Power tools can be utilized to speed up a project and make it easier, however, they can also be hazardous. Accidents to workers using hand and buy power tools online tools are expensive for both the worker and their employer, particularly when they require medical attention or time off from work. Although power tools have many safety features, the safety of the user is essential to ensure they are safe.

Many injuries that occur while using power tools could be avoided with better practices for users. For example, a person must ensure that the tool is shut off and unplugged when not being used. Also, he or she should examine the tool prior to using it to ensure the blades, bits, and other moving parts are free of obstructions. The tool should be kept clear from water and substances that ignite should not be exposed to it.

In addition, a person should not alter safety features or eliminate them completely. Also, a person must wear the appropriate personal protective equipment, like goggles or eye protection, earplugs, muffs or earplugs and gloves. This will help prevent any dust, fumes or other hazardous materials from being inhaled and causing health problems.

A worker should make sure to select the right power tool for a given job. The wrong tool could cause accidents due to shattering, bursting or increasing the amount of dust or debris produced. The user should adhere to the manufacturer's recommendations regarding lubrication and changing the accessories.

Regularly maintaining power tools will extend their life and performance. Always read the instruction manual and follow the maintenance procedures that come with the package. Regularly inspecting power tools and replacing components that are damaged or worn can reduce the chance of accident or injury. Reporting any defects or damages to a supervisor can aid in addressing the issue. A well-lit, clean work area is also important for power tool safety. Unclean benches and inadequate lighting can result in injuries when tools are dropped or moved.
